  7. I'm originally from Osaka and with that building with free way panetrating through it, it wasn't originally designed to do that at all. I heard that when the city developer had already planned the exact passage for the free way, they didn't have any communication with the private building owner which became obviously a bit of a conflict between them in the beginning. Apparently it took about 5 years to settle the issues between the owner of the land/building and the city. For the building owner/landlord also had already planned to build a high rise building given the fact that the price of the land was rising and it was much more beneficial for the owner to build it higher up as most building development has the same thing in mind, the building owner came to the solution to compromise and cut a hole to the original structure plan so they both can coexist. In the meantime the city also saved quite a bit of funds by not buying off the land which is more common when the cities plan to build roads and free ways through the residential or business districts. It was build in 1992 and it was quite a controversial topic around that time in the city when I was still living in Osaka.
